Through manual manipulation of the spine delivered to the highest standards by licensed chiropractors, chiropractic care works to restore and maintain proper communication from your brain to your body by relieving what chiropractors refer to as a subluxation, or a misalignment, of the spine. Dr. Joshua Wood was raised in Richmond, Virginia, and has always had a passion for understanding the human body and mind. He began his academic journey at Virginia Tech, where he earned his undergraduate degree in 2010, followed by a master’s degree from UNC-Wilmington in 2015, studying chemistry, biochemistry, and psychology.
His chiropractic journey began in San Jose, California, after graduating from Palmer College of Chiropractic West in 2022. Since then, he has practiced in several locations across California, including Hayward, Milpitas, and Gilroy. In May 2025, Dr. Wood proudly joined The Joint Chiropractic team, where he continues to serve the community with passion and dedication.

Dr. Wegayeu Gizaw was born and raised in the Southern part of Ethiopia (Sidama) on a coffee farm that his family owned. He moved to the United States in 2005 right after graduating from high school and attended Luzerne County Community College, where he received an Associates Degree in Surgical Technology. Dr. Gizaw continued in the medical field, studying Biochemistry at Misericordia University in 2011.
Upon receiving his Doctor of Chiropractic degree from New York Chiropractic College, Dr. Gizaw taught Anatomy and Physiology at Lackawanna College in Scranton Pennsylvania, then moved to Virginia to become Clinic Director at The Joint Chiropractic in Stafford.
